How much do entry level draftsman j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 10, 2026, the average hourly pay for entry level draftsman in Indiana is $25.56,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$20.14 and $29.04 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are entry level draftsmen?

Entry level draftsmen are professionals who create technical drawings and plans used in construction, manufacturing, and engineering projects. They typically work under the supervision of more experienced draftsmen or engineers and use computer-aided design (CAD) software to produce detailed diagrams based on specifications. Their responsibilities may include revising drawings, preparing layouts, and ensuring that plans comply with industry standards. Entry level draftsmen often have an associate degree or a certificate in drafting and are building foundational skills in the field.

What are some common challenges faced by entry level draftsmen, and how can they overcome them?

Entry level draftsmen often encounter challenges such as adapting to new drafting software, interpreting complex design specifications, and ensuring accuracy in technical drawings under tight deadlines. To overcome these challenges, it's important to seek feedback from senior team members, participate in hands-on training sessions, and consistently review project requirements before starting each task. Developing strong communication skills and asking clarifying questions can also help ensure your work aligns with engineers’ or architects’ expectations.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Entry Level Draftsman,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Entry Level Draftsman, you need fundamental knowledge of drafting techniques, attention to detail, and a relevant associate degree or technical certification. Proficiency in CAD software such as AutoCAD or SolidWorks and familiarity with industry standards are typically required. Strong communication, organization, and the ability to follow instructions help set candidates apart in this role. These skills and qualifications are crucial for producing precise technical drawings that support engineers and architects in delivering accurate project plans.

About the Role

We are seeking a motivated Entry-Level GIS Technician to join our team. This role supports the planning, design, construction, and documentation of fiber optic infrastructure projects. You'll work closely with network engineers, drafters, and construction teams to ensure accurate spatial data management and as-built documentation throughout the project lifecycle.

Key Responsibilities

GIS Data Management & Analysis

  • Collect, validate, and maintain geospatial data for fiber optic networks using ArcGIS PRO, ArcGIS Online, Vetro Fiber Maps, and home-grown systems
  • Create and update digital maps showing fiber routes, conduit paths, splice points, and network nodes
  • Perform spatial analysis to support route planning and network optimization
  • Ensure data integrity across multiple datasets and coordinate systems

Drafting & Design Support

  • Assist in creating construction drawings and GIS layers for fiber optic network designs
  • Convert field survey data into digital formats for engineering review
  • Prepare plot-ready maps for permitting, construction, and client deliverables
  • Maintain version control for all design documents and spatial data

Construction Tracking & As-Builts

  • Track construction progress against approved designs using field data collection tools
  • Document field changes and update as-built data to reflect actual installed conditions
  • Coordinate with field crews to verify construction progress

Quality Assurance

  • Review GIS data for accuracy, completeness, and consistency
  • Identify and resolve data discrepancies between design and field conditions
  • Participate in QA/QC processes for all deliverables
